The premises used to be La Biciclette, an unaffordable French speciality restaurant. Now it's a downmarket spaghetti joint. The room is a big cavern, with no attempt at atmosphere and it can be cold and draughty. The floor and walls are all hard surfaces, so if it's busy it can be very noisy.
